Description

Dive into the expansive soundscape possibilities with the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ection, a comprehensive suite of high-end modules designed for Voltage Modular. This collection showcases Cherry Audio's knack for perfectly blending vintage charm with modern innovation, making it an essential toolkit for any synthesizer enthusiast.

At its core, the collection features the Polymode, a synthesizer module inspired by the iconic 70s Polymoog, renowned for its sweeping pads and vocal-like tones. Meanwhile, SynthVoice encapsulates the vintage allure of the ARP 2600, delivering an authentic semi-modular experience with robust oscillators, dynamic filters, and lush spring reverb.

For those seeking the classic Juno-106 vibe, the DCO-60 module offers a fully-polyphonic experience, complete with the dreamy self-oscillating filters and rich chorus effects reminiscent of the original. The accompanying VCF-60 and Chorus-60 modules enhance this experience further by providing standalone filter and chorus functionalities with precision and flexibility.

AirStep and AirWave modules elevate your sound design with their advanced wave sequencing and vector mixing capabilities, boasting over 300 PCM sample waves and joystick-controlled interfaces for effortless modulation. The Poly variations extend these features into a polyphonic realm, allowing for the creation of dense, evolving soundscapes.

The collection is rounded off with the FM Station and EG Station modules, bringing the classic Yamaha FM synthesis and versatile envelope control to your modular rack for intricate sound crafting.

Key Features:

  • Polymode synthesizer inspired by the legendary Polymoog
  • SynthVoice module with two oscillators and spring reverb
  • DCO-60, VCF-60, and Chorus-60 for classic Juno-106 sounds
  • AirStep and AirWave with joystick-controlled vector mixing
  • Poly AirWave and Poly EG Station for polyphonic capabilities
  • FM Station for classic Yamaha FM synthesis
  • Compatible with Windows and macOS, including M1 processors
  • Requires Voltage Modular for use

FAQs

What type of instruments are included in the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ection?

The Cherry Audio Year Two Collection is specifically focused on synthesizers, offering a variety of virtual synths to expand your sound palette.

Is the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ection suitable for beginners in music production?

Yes, the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ection is designed with an intuitive user interface, making it accessible for beginners while still providing powerful sound design capabilities for advanced users.

Can I use the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ection with my existing DAW?

The Cherry Audio Year Two Collection is compatible with most popular DAWs, allowing seamless integration into your existing music production setup.

Does the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ection require a hardware controller?

No, the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ection does not require a hardware controller, as it is a software-only package designed for use within your DAW.

How many computers can I install the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ection on?

You can activate the Cherry Audio Year Two Collection on up to four computers simultaneously, with the option to manage activations through your Cherry Audio account.
